A migraine is a headache that can cause severe throbbing pain or a pulsing sensation, usually on one side of the head. It's often accompanied by nausea, vomiting, and extreme sensitivity to light and sound. Migraine attacks can last for hours to days, and the pain can be so severe that it interferes with your daily activities.

WebMar 21, 2024 · Antidepressants for Preventive Treatment of Migraine Antidepressants are commonly used as migraine preventives. Amitriptyline has the best evidence for use in migraine prevention. Nortriptyline is an alternative in patients who may not tolerate amitriptyline. Both men and women get migraines, but women are three times more likely to have migraine headaches than men. The incidence of migraines is also higher in young people between the ages of 18 - 44.
